Though there are quite a few Pokemon fan games centered around Ash, many consider Ash Gray to be the very best. The game allows players to control Ash Ketchum and follows the events of the Pokemon anime rather than the ones from the original gen 1 and gen 3 games. Pokemon Ash Gray is a rom hack, which, like many other Pokemon rom hacks, is built around the original release of Pokemon FireRed.
